The product characteristic spherical roller bearing has two rows of spherical rollers; the outer ring has a concave spherical raceway; the inner ring has two concave raceways which are oblique to the bearing axis; the center of curvature of the outer ring raceway and the bearing The center. The spherical roller bearing is self-aligning; it is not affected by the misalignment of the shaft and the bearing housing or the deflection of the shaft; it can compensate for the concentricity error caused by this. In addition to receiving radial load, this type of bearing It can also accept two-way axial load and its combined load; the bearing capacity is larger; together it has better anti-sensation and impact resistance.
Spherical roller bearings are mainly used in various mechanical equipment such as steel, mining, paper, ship, textile machinery, coal mill, electric power, etc.; they are the most widely used type of bearings in the machinery industry.
● Product classification ZWZ spherical roller bearings can be divided into the following types:
Cylindrical hole spherical roller bearing tapered hole spherical roller bearing oscillating sieve with spherical roller bearing split type spherical roller bearing cylindrical hole spherical roller bearing according to the inner ring with or without ribs and selected support frame The same; can be divided into CA type and C type. CA type spherical roller bearing inner ring has two small ribs at both ends; the center has no ribs; the support frame is a two-prong one-piece layout physical support frame; the information is usually copper Or carbon steel; the layout bearing is used in large and extra large bearings. The inner ring of C-type spherical roller bearing does not have large and small ribs; the roller is “self-guided”; the center is the active retaining ring; The frame is a stamping plate holder; the roller length of the layout bearing is added; the additional load is improved; and the higher limit speed and lower collision loss are also achieved.
Conical bore spherical roller bearings have the characteristics of cylindrical bore spherical roller bearings; but the inner bore is a tapered bore; the conventional taper is 1:12; its type is the basic type of bearing plus K, but the taper of 240 and 241 series bearings It is 1:30; its type is the basic type of bearing and K30 is added. The tapered hole bearing can be directly mounted on the tapered journal by nut; it can also be fixed on the cylindrical shaft by using the adapter sleeve or the push sleeve.
The new anti-oscillation spherical roller bearing for spherical roller bearings for oscillating screens; it is a new layout bearing specially developed by ZWZ for the oscillating machine type mainframe; it is also suitable for common mechanical equipment. Its function: high bearing capacity and resistance Impact, anti-oscillation, small conflict, low temperature rise, long service life.
The basic shape is selected; the inner ring has a fixed middle rib; the axial force can be accepted, the special layout type is adopted for the bracket; the inner and outer diameters are bidirectionally guided; the guiding gap is controlled, and the movement of the bracket and the inner and outer rings is controlled. ; can be anti-vibration and vibration reduction.
Spherical roller bearings for oscillating screens are marked with the rear code VB.

Split spherical roller bearings are marked with the rear code D. â–  The basic dimensions of the scale-size ZWZ spherical roller bearings are listed in the bearing scale data sheet;
Inner diameter scale: 30mm ~ 1800mm
Outer diameter scale: 68mm ~ 2180mm
Width scale: 20mm ~ 530 mm
â—† The precision of ZWZ spherical roller bearing products has P0 and P6 grades. For users with special needs, P5 grade products can also be processed. The public service is in accordance with GB307.
▲ Radial clearance ZWZ spherical roller bearing has C2, standard (CN), C3, C4 and C5 internal clearance; all coincide with GB4604. Conical hole spherical roller bearing with C3 clearance as the specification clearance. The values ​​are for unmounted and unloaded bearings.
Bearings with a value greater than or less than the clearance specification can also be produced according to the user's requirements. The spherical roller bearing for the oscillating screen is the C4 group clearance.
★ Adhere to the CA type spherical roller bearing; the bracket is usually made of solid brass, bronze or carbon steel; the C-type spherical roller bearing; the bracket is usually selected from the steel plate.
